FLOODS IN HAWKE'S BAY.
Unprecedentedly Heavy Rai
[United Press Association*!.
Napier, This Day,
The low-lying lands in the Hawke's Bay district have once more been subjected to floods. Tho rain kept up continuously all yesterday, and last night the downpour was unprecedently heay. Reports from Meaneo, Papakuna, and tlie neighbouring country show that these places aro badly flooded, but Clive escaped, as, through the action of the River Board, a good mouth has been made to tho river.
